Wigan Athletic part company with Manager Warren Joyce.
Graham Barrow made Interim Manager for the remainder of the season.
“The standard of our play has been below expectation” – David Sharpe

Looking at the Stats for both men as wigan manager win% is poor. Barrow is only 32.67% for his entire 450 games as a manager. wont be good enough to keep them up



Joyce P24 W6 D5 L13 WIN%25.0
Barrow P61 W19 D14 L28 WIN%31.15
BARROW AS CARETAKER P2 L2 WIN%00
